Cattle auctions at Ashburn (1226) Athens (444), Donalsonville (322), Jackson (281) Moultrie (149) and Washington (186). Compared to last week: Slaughter cows and bulls steady to 2.00 lower. Feeder classes over 600 lbs steady to 3.00 higher, under 600 lbs mostly 2.00 to 4.00 higher. Replacement cows mostly steady.
